【摘要】 角钢的受力性能对预应力自复位框架结构(PTED)的抗震性能有着重要的影响。为了研究角钢的拉压恢复力模型,完成10对角钢的拟静力试验,在试验研究的基础上,构建角钢的拉压恢复力模型,给出角钢屈服荷载的计算公式;利用试验结果验证角钢受拉初始刚度计算公式的准确性,对角钢的屈服后荷载进行线性回归并得到角钢的屈服后刚度表达式;基于角钢的拉压恢复力模型,对角钢的拟静力试验进行数值模拟,所得结果与试验结果吻合良好,验证角钢拉压恢复力模型的准确性。

【Abstract】 The performance of the angles has an important influence on the seismic performance of the self-centering post-tensioned precast structure(simplified as PTED). In order to study the restoring force model of the angles under repeated tension and compression, the 10 quasi-static tests of the angles are completed. The restoring force model of the angles under tension and compression are proposed on the basis of the experimental study. The accuracy of calculation for yield load and initial stiffness of the angles are verified and the formula of the yield load is modified based on the test results. The linear regression is made for the load after yield and the expression of the stiffness after yield is obtained. Based on the restoring force model of the angles, the quasi-static tests of the angles are simulated and the results are in good agreement with those obtained in the tests. The correctness of the tension and compression restoring force model for the angles is verified.
